Summary

  • ext:ref-audio-choice: gapped sentence + N audio options, one correct (idea 1)
  • ext:ref-audio-tiles: spoken source sentence + word-tile translation puzzle (idea 2)
  • ext:ref-speak-and-record: speaker + show + record, deliberately ungraded (idea 3, engine half)

All three follow the established self-contained ext_payload pattern from ext:ref-dictation/ext:ref-image-description (engine#68): no core-schema change, no card reference.

Three language-learning exercise ideas, audited against the existing
audio/image reference extensions (engine#68) and found missing: a
gapped sentence with audio options, a spoken sentence built as a
translation from word tiles, and an ungraded speak-and-record
activity. All three follow the established self-contained ext_payload
shape; ref-speak-and-record is the first reference extension with no
grade function, since a recording has nothing to check it against.
